Twenty people in Abu Dhabi will shape how US military uses AI

AI
Representative image of President of the UAE Sheikh Mohamed bin Zayed Al Nahyan and US President Donald Trump at launch of 5GW UAE-US AI Campus. (Image via G42)

Key ideas

  • The US and UAE are establishing Task Force Talon Synapse, the first bilateral military AI unit, to accelerate intelligence analysis, cyber defence, and regional threat monitoring.
  • The task force will use AI to process real-world operational data, including missile interceptions, drone activity, and maritime surveillance, instead of simulated datasets.
  • The initiative follows expanded US approval for advanced Nvidia AI chips in the UAE, providing the computing power needed for next-generation military AI systems.

Since February 2026, the Emirati military has been intercepting thousands of incoming Iranian missiles. It has carried out joint attacks on Iranian weapons sites, shared intelligence with American forces in the area, and helped keep commercial shipping moving through the Strait of Hormuz as Iranian pressure increased on that route. In response, Iran has targeted military sites and attacked important infrastructure in the UAE and US data processing facilities located in the UAE.

As a result, on July 28, US Central Command (CENTCOM) announced an agreement with the UAE to establish the Task Force Talon Synapse, the first bilateral military AI unit between any two countries. About 20 American and Emirati specialists in artificial intelligence, data science, and cybersecurity will work together in Abu Dhabi.

The group plans to use artificial intelligence to process intelligence faster, protecting critical infrastructure from the kinds of attacks that have already happened there, and improving how both militaries monitor a regional security environment that has been continuously active for months. The memorandum of understanding formalising the task force has not yet been signed, but CENTCOM says it will be in the coming weeks.

The focus area

CENTCOM faces a challenge in processing information fast enough for modern military operations. The amount of data from tracking thousands of Iranian missiles, monitoring drone activity from Yemen, observing maritime traffic in Hormuz, and maintaining awareness across the Gulf, Red Sea, and Arabian Sea is too much for human analysts to handle in the short time required for military decisions.

AI systems can process this data for sensor fusion, target classification, and pattern recognition. They can rapidly identify threats, find unusual patterns, and help make targeting decisions faster than any other method. Since February, the UAE and its American partners have been collecting this kind of operational data. Unlike most countries testing military AI with fake data, Task Force Talon Synapse will work with real data.

Iran has attacked US data processing facilities in the UAE. These facilities are crucial for the command and communication systems that American forces rely on in the region. To protect these facilities from cyberattacks, CENTCOM needs AI to monitor network traffic, detect unusual activity quickly, and automate responses faster than a human can analyse an alert.

CENTCOM and the Gulf

CENTCOM has experience working in the Gulf region. Task Force 59 began in September 2021 and has spent five years using AI with unmanned maritime systems. It has conducted joint exercises with Emirati forces and developed patterns for how autonomous and semi-autonomous platforms can support naval operations.

The newly proposed Task Force Talon Synapse builds on this work in a new area, such as intelligence, infrastructure, and regional monitoring. It brings together American and Emirati specialists on the same team, allowing them to collaborate instead of working separately and sharing results afterwards.

In 2023, the Biden administration denied a request from the UAE for advanced Nvidia AI chips. It was worried that the technology could end up in China through third-party channels. As a result, G42, a state-linked AI group in Abu Dhabi, ended its partnerships with Chinese technology companies and built what the US State Department described in April 2026 as a Regulated Technology Environment, a governance framework for managing sensitive technology jointly agreed with the United States.

In July 2026, the Commerce Department made it easier for Emirati organisations to access advanced AI hardware. Now, the organisations can obtain advanced computing chips without needing individual export licenses, and the announcement about the task force and the approval for chip access happened just days apart.

The UAE now has access to Nvidia’s most advanced chips, which are necessary for CENTCOM to run its intelligence and protect its infrastructure effectively. Without these chips, the required computing power was not available until this month.

The AI force

Admiral Brad Cooper, the CENTCOM Commander, called Task Force Talon Synapse a considerable achievement in military cooperation on AI. However, the more important aspect is how this will be used in real operations. The conflict in the Gulf has produced a lot of real military data, such as tracking, interception, network intrusion, and maritime surveillance data.

The data is essential for making artificial intelligence systems work well in military decision-making. Currently, this data is in Abu Dhabi, where a task force is being set up. The future of the team of 20 people in an office in Abu Dhabi depends on what happens after the paperwork is signed. It will depend on the resources that come after the announcement and whether support for military-level AI development is available in the coming months.

CENTCOM has not yet explained which systems the task force will develop, which AI models it will choose, or how it will apply these results in real operations. But such unanswered questions will decide if Task Force Talon Synapse becomes a useful tool or stays just a concept.
